The story of the Indian family lifestyle is one of constant negotiation. It is a balancing act between the ancient and the avant-garde, the community and the individual. While the physical structures of homes may change from mud-walled houses to glass condominiums, the emotional architecture remains identical. It is a lifestyle anchored by a profound reverence for elders, an obsession with nourishing loved ones, and an unshakeable belief that life is best experienced not alone, but in the vibrant, noisy, and comforting company of family.
